Whoosh is an intrepid band of cyclists of all ages, many of whom have been cycling together every May Bank Holiday since 2003. Each year we take 4-5 days to cycle somewhere in the UK, to enjoy cycling, the countryside, good company, and to raise money for charity. This year we are cycling from Fishguard, south Wales to the Lincolnshire coast; diagonally across Wales and England.
We want to support Wheels for Wellbeing, a charity that is local to us that promotes inclusive cycling. Giving everyone the chance to enjoy the great outdoors on a bicycle is a cause that is close to our hearts but we know it is difficult for lots of people because of illness or disability. Wheels for Wellbeing makes it possible for more people to discover the fun and independence of cycling with their adapted cycles, helpers and supported cycling sessions.
